International Business Studies in Paris
France
Term: Spring
Dates: mid-January to mid-May
Description:
Students will participate in the International Semester. Classes are comprised of both international and French students, and are taught by French and European faculty. Courses are available in both English and French. Courses taught in English: - Intercultural Management - International Communication and Consumer Behavior - European Marketing and Management of a Product Line - Organizations Department and Cross-Cultural Development - The United States of Europe - International Negotiation - International Corporate Finance - International Marketing and Distribution - International Business Law Courses taught in French: - International Business Law - Finances: Consolidation des Acquis - Finances: Création d'Entreprise - Finances: Business Plan/Marketing - Informatique: Concevoir realiser et mettre en ligne un site Web - International Marketing/Distribution - KU course equivalencies for Negocia International Semester
Highlights:
Founded in 1992 by the Paris Chamber of Commerce and Industry (CCIP), NEGOCIA is an international academic institution dedicated to marketing, sales, international trade and business negotiation. Sixty permanent faculty and 500 regular visiting lecturers from the business community provide students with a thoroughly modern and constantly evolving curriculum. Located within the city of Paris, a major center of world trade and commerce, NEGOCIA offers ultra-modern facilities including a multimedia resource center and independent study labs.

Cost in US$: (2008-2009 Academic Year $6,980 - $7,280)
Cost Include Description:
KU Students: $6,980 for the Spring semester Non-KU Students: $7,280 for the Spring semesterThe program fee includes tuition, fees, emergency medical evacuation and repatriation services, and KU orientation. Additional costs: Room and board ($14,600), airfare, passport and French Visa fees, books, local transportation, and personal expenses. Note: All dates, costs, and program information are subject to change as necessary due to fluctuations in the exchange rate or other reasons.
